package query_manager
import (
"github.com/opensds/multi-cloud/metadata/pkg/model"
"testing"
)
func TestPaginate(t *testing.T) {
tests := []struct {
unPaginatedResult []*model.MetaBackend
limit int32
offset int32
expectedResult []*model.MetaBackend
}{
{
unPaginatedResult: []*model.MetaBackend{
{Id: "1"},
{Id: "2"},
{Id: "3"},
{Id: "4"},
{Id: "5"},
},
limit: 2,
offset: 0,
expectedResult: []*model.MetaBackend{
{Id: "1"},
{Id: "2"},
},
},
{
unPaginatedResult: []*model.MetaBackend{
{Id: "1"},
{Id: "2"},
{Id: "3"},
{Id: "4"},
{Id: "5"},
},
limit: 2,
offset: 2,
expectedResult: []*model.MetaBackend{
{Id: "3"},
{Id: "4"},
},
},
{
unPaginatedResult: []*model.MetaBackend{
{Id: "1"},
{Id: "2"},
{Id: "3"},
{Id: "4"},
{Id: "5"},
},
limit: 2,
offset: 5,
expectedResult: []*model.MetaBackend{},
},
{
unPaginatedResult: []*model.MetaBackend{},
limit: 2,
offset: 0,
expectedResult: []*model.MetaBackend{},
},
}
for i, test := range tests {
result := Paginate(test.unPaginatedResult, test.limit, test.offset)
if len(result) != len(test.expectedResult) {
t.Errorf("Test case %d: expected length of result to be %d but got %d", i, len(test.expectedResult), len(result))
}
for j, r := range result {
if r.Id != test.expectedResult[j].Id {
t.Errorf("Test case %d: expected result at index %d to be %s but got %s", i, j, test.expectedResult[j].Id, r.Id)
}
}
}
}
